Online Course Writer

Local 39 Training Department is a nonprofit organization based in San Francisco that conducts training for members or those interested in becoming members of the Stationary Engineers Union, member organization (IUOE). Stationary Engineers maintain commercial and industrial facilities and therefore must maintain a wide variety of skilled trades knowledge. These skills include, Automation, Carpentry, Controls, Electricity, Electronics, Fire Control Systems, Heating Ventilation and Air Conditioning, IT network basics, Locksmithing, Machinery Maintenance, Plumbing, Power Generation, Print Reading and CAD draft update, Steam Production and Welding.
